`

svg标签

    博客分类:
  • Java
 
阅读更多
Property
Trait Getter
[possible return value(s)]
Trait Setter
[allowed value(s)]
Default Values




<svg>, <rect>, <circle>, <ellipse>, <line>, <path>, <g>, <image>, <text>, <a>, and <use>
color
getRGBColorTrait [SVGRGBColor]
setTrait [inherit]
setRGBColorTrait [SVGRGBColor]
rgb(0,0,0)
display
getTrait [inline | none ]
setTrait [inline | none | inherit ] "inline"
fill
getRGBColorTrait [null, SVGRGBColor]
setRGBColorTrait [SVGRGBColor]
setTrait(none | currentColor | inherit)
rgb(0,0,0)
fill-rule
getTrait [nonzero | evenodd]
setTrait [nonzero | evenodd | inherit] "nonzero"
stroke getRGBColorTrait [null, SVGRGBColor] setRGBColorTrait [SVGRGBColor]
setTrait [none | currentColor | inherit] "none"
stroke-dashoffset getFloatTrait setTrait [inherit]
setFloatTrait 0.0f
stroke-linecap getTrait [butt | round | square] setTrait [butt | round | square | inherit] "butt"
stroke-linejoin getTrait [miter | round | bevel ] setTrait [miter | round | bevel | inherit] "miter"
stroke-miterlimit getFloatTrait [ value >= 1] setTrait [inherit]
setFloatTrait [value >= 1] 4.0f
stroke-width getFloatTrait [value >= 0] setTrait [inherit]
setFloatTrait [value >= 0] 1.0f
visibility getTrait [visible | hidden] setTrait [visible | hidden | inherit] "visible"




<svg>, <text>, <g>, <a>, and <use>;
font-family
getTrait [single, computed font-family value]
setTrait [same syntax as font-family attribute]
User-Agent
font-size
getFloatTrait  [value >= 0]
setFloatTrait [value >= 0]
setTrait [inherit]
User-Agent
font-style
getTrait [normal | italic | oblique ] setTrait [normal | italic | oblique | inherit] "normal"
font-weight
getTrait [100 | 200 | 300
| 400 | 500 | 600 | 700 | 800 | 900 ] setTrait [normal | bold | bolder | lighter | 100 | 200 | 300
| 400 | 500 | 600 | 700 | 800 | 900 | inherit] "normal"
text-anchor
getTrait [start | middle | end]
setTrait [start | middle | end | inherit ]
"start"

Attribute
Trait Getter
Trait Setter
Default Values




<rect>, <circle>, <ellipse>, <line>, <path>, <g>, <image>, <text>, <a>, and <use>
transform
getMatrixTrait [SVGMatrix]
setMatrixTrait [SVGMatrix]
Identity matrix
(1,0,0,1,0,0)




<rect>
height
getFloatTrait [ value >= 0]
setFloatTrait [ value >= 0]
REQUIRED
(0.0f)
width
getFloatTrait [ value >= 0] setFloatTrait [ value >= 0] REQUIRED
(0.0f)
x
getFloatTrait
setFloatTrait
0.0f
y
getFloatTrait
setFloatTrait
0.0f
rx
getFloatTrait [value >= 0] setFloatTrait [value >= 0] 0.0f
ry
getFloatTrait [value >= 0]
setFloatTrait [value >= 0]
0.0f




<circle>
cx
getFloatTrait
setFloatTrait
0.0f
cy
getFloatTrait
setFloatTrait
0.0f
r
getFloatTrait [ value >= 0]
setFloatTrait [value >= 0]
REQUIRED
(0.0f)




<ellipse>
cx
getFloatTrait
setFloatTrait
0.0f
cy
getFloatTrait
setFloatTrait
0.0f
rx
getFloatTrait [value >= 0]
setFloatTrait [value >= 0]
REQUIRED
(0.0f)
ry
getFloatTrait [value >= 0]
setFloatTrait [value >= 0]
REQUIRED
(0.0f)




<line>
x1
getFloatTrait
setFloatTrait
0.0f
x2
getFloatTrait
setFloatTrait
0.0f
y1
getFloatTrait
setFloatTrait
0.0f
y2
getFloatTrait
setFloatTrait
0.0f




<path> (path-length is not supported)
d
getPathTrait [SVGPath]
setPathTrait [SVGPath]
REQUIRED
(Empty SVGPath)




<image>
x
getFloatTrait
setFloatTrait
0.0f
y
getFloatTrait
setFloatTrait
0.0f
width
getFloatTrait [value >= 0]
setFloatTrait [value >= 0]
REQUIRED
(0.0f)
height
getFloatTrait [value >= 0]
setFloatTrait [value >= 0]
REQUIRED
(0.0f)
xlink:href
getTrait NS[absolute URI]
setTraitNS [non local-URI value]
REQUIRED
( "" )




<use>
x
getFloatTrait
setFloatTrait
0.0f
y
getFloatTrait
setFloatTrait
0.0f
xlink:href
getTraitNS[absolute URI]
setTraitNS
""




<a>
target
getTrait
setTrait
""
xlink:href
getTraitNS[absolute URI]
setTraitNS
""




<text>
(Notes: For 'x' and 'y', it is only possible to provide floating point scalar values; an array of x or y values is not supported.
'rotate' attribute is not supported.)
x
getFloatTrait
setFloatTrait
0.0f
y
getFloatTrait
setFloatTrait
0.0f
#text
getTrait [not null]
setTrait [not null]
""




<svg>
version
getTrait
Not available (readonly)
"1.1"
baseProfile
getTrait
Not available (readonly)
"tiny"
viewBox
getRectTrait [null, SVGRect]
setRectTrait [SVGRect]
null
zoomAndPan
getTrait [disable | magnify]
setTrait [disable | magnify]
"magnify"
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ics